Heat perfusion for malignancy.

Chandrakant Vitthal Patel1, Suman G Kinare, Prafullakumar K Sen

  • 1K.E.M. Hospital, Mumbai, India.

Indian Journal of Surgical Oncology
|June 14, 2012
PubMed
Summary

This study combined hyperthermia, anoxia, and low pH to target cancer cells. The novel perfusion method proved safe for normal tissues and selectively harmful to malignant cells in early trials.

Background:

  • Malignant cells exhibit selective sensitivity to hyperthermia, total anoxia, and low pH.
  • These conditions can induce lethal effects specifically in cancerous tissues.
  • Previous research indicates potential for combining these modalities for enhanced cancer treatment.

Purpose of the Study:

  • To develop and evaluate a novel perfusion system combining hyperthermia, total anoxia, and low pH.
  • To assess the safety and efficacy of this combined modality treatment in advanced malignancy.
  • To explore the potential application of this technique in regional infusion therapies.

Main Methods:

  • A specialized perfusion system was designed to deliver combined hyperthermia, total anoxia, and low pH.
  • The system was tested in four patients with advanced malignancy.
  • Treatment duration was standardized at 45 minutes per session.

Main Results:

  • The 45-minute perfusion procedure was found to be safe for normal tissues.
  • The combined modalities demonstrated selective injury to malignant cells.
  • The procedure was technically straightforward to implement.

Conclusions:

  • The combined hyperthermia, anoxia, and low pH perfusion system shows promise as a selective cancer treatment.
  • The method is safe for normal tissues and warrants further investigation.
  • Its simplicity suggests potential for broader application, including regional infusion.
